Audi e-tron customers in Singapore now have two high-speed facilities to charge from...

BY Vivek Max R

… and get their cars washed for free while they’re at it.

This promotion runs until the end of 2021, and includes complimentary rapid DC charging for up to 2 hours.

This is in addition to the benefits already enjoyed by customers who purchase their Audi e-tron from Premium Automobiles - an integrated charging solution offered in collaboration with SP Group, which includes the installation of an AC charger where possible, and up to 18 months of free charging at all SP Group public charging networks.

One of the most common reasons local drivers cite about their reluctance to switch to an Electric Vehicle (EV) is the lack of charging infrastructure. Also, fast charging beyond 50kW DC is still a rarity so early adopters have to put up with relatively long charging periods which makes them less convenient than Internal Combustion Engine (ICE) cars.

Therefore, these efforts are part of Audi’s progressive sustainability roadmap to drive greater adoption of electric vehicles (EVs), especially in Singapore.

As the range of e-tron models has grown to four, the introduction of free charging and car wash services can only make the prospect of Audi EV ownership more compelling than ever.
